Parapapillary gamma zone associated with increased peripapillary scleral bowing: the Beijing Eye Study 2011

This study found that the backward configuration of the peripapillary sclera is associated with the presence, size, and extent of the parapapillary gamma zone. The results suggest that the sclera and the Bruch's membrane play an important role in the biomechanical behavior of the optic nerve head.
Aims To investigate the association between the backward configuration of the peripapillary sclera (PPS), measured as PPS angle (PPSA), and presence and extent of parapapillary gamma zone. Methods Out of the population-based Beijing Eye Study 2011, we randomly selected individuals free of optic nerve and retinal diseases. With Spectralis optical coherence tomography, we measured gamma zone (zone free of Bruch's membrane (BM)) and determined the PPSA, defined as the angle between the anterior scleral surface lines from both sides of the optic nerve head (ONH). Results The study included 678 individuals with age of 59.5 +/- 7.6 years (range: 50-90) and axial length of 23.5 +/- 1.3 mm (20.9-29.2). Gamma zone was more prevalent in eyes with larger PPSA (p=0.006) after adjustment for axial length (p<0.001) and BM opening area (p<0.001). Gamma zone width was positively associated with PPSA, axial length and BM opening area (all p<0.001) in multivariable analysis. Circular gamma zone was accompanied with larger PPSA as compared with focal gamma zone (19.9 degrees +/- 7.2 degrees vs 6.3 degrees +/- 5.3 degrees, p<0.001). Focal temporal gamma and focal inferior gamma had similar mean PPSA (p=0.69). However, the horizontal PPSA was significantly larger than the vertical PPSA in inferior gamma (6.9 degrees +/- 6.3 degrees vs 4.7 degrees +/- 6.6 degrees; p=0.005), while they were comparable in temporal gamma (6.1 degrees +/- 5.8 degrees vs 6.3 degrees +/- 6.4 degrees; p=0.073). Conclusions A more backward bowing of the PPS was linearly and spatially associated with the presence, size and extent of gamma zone. It suggested that the BM and the sclera were closely related in participating the biomechanical behaviour of the ONH.
